TRAJAN. 98-117 AD. Æ Sestertius (32mm, 23.08 g). Struck circa 103 AD. Laureate head right / Arabia standing facing, head left, holding branch and bundle of cinnamon sticks(?); camel at her feet to left. RIC II 466; Cohen 32. Good VF, river patina, a little porous.
From the Tony Hardy Collection.
